Conference: "Social commitment and tax breaks, two good reasons to give!

Whether personal conviction, choice, tax advantages, generosity - there are many good reasons to give! During this conference, donors and experts will answer all your questions.

Have you often thought about giving, but have never taken the time to look into it? Do you have questions about the advantages and disadvantages of donating, but don't know the right expert to answer them?

On 7 December, KEDGE Alumni and the KEDGE Foundation are holding an exceptional webinar with two graduate donors, who will share their personal motivations for giving. there are many reasons to give, Whether it's on a personal or company behalf, out of generosity or conviction, or because of a desire to increase one's commitment to a better society,  but each one is unique. And because giving carries with it certain fiscal and legal implications, it was inconceivable for us not to invite an expert to this round table to answer your questions and explain the fiscal advantages of making this choice. Donations, legacies, pro bono... Alexandra Brehar, a lawyer specialising in corporate law, will explain all the types of donations you can make and the advantages of each one.

Speaking of donations...

KEDGE has launched its first fundraising campaign among its Alumni network so that it can continue to support students experiencing difficulties. KEDGE Alumni is also participating by donating one euro for each profile updated until 30 November 2021.
